Response of geranium (Pelargonium graveolenus L.) to gamma irradiation and foliar application of speed grow

摘要

Field experiments were carried out during two successive seasons to investigate the effect of gamma rays (0, 2 and 4 K-tad) and/or foliar application of Speed Grow fertilizer (0, 1000 and 2000 ppm) on growth and volatile oil composition of geranium (Pelargonium graveolenus L.). The maximum values of growth characters and volatile oil yield were obtained as a result of the interaction treatment between irradiation at 2 K-tad and foliar spray of Speed Grow at 1000 ppm. Citronellol which is the main component of geranium volatile oil was reached its maximum value as a result of gamma rays at 2 K-rad in combination wih foliar spray at 2000 ppm.
